Star Wars really said love is never just love, itâs always a force that either steadies you⌠or exposes exactly where youâre weakest.
Anakin and PadmĂŠ are what happens when love becomes possession disguised as devotion. They love each other deeply, intensely, but itâs built on fearâfear of loss, fear of change, fear of being alone again. And that fear doesnât just sit quietly. It grows. It twists. Until love stops being something that frees you and starts becoming something you try to control. Their tragedy isnât that they loved too much. Itâs that they couldnât trust that love to exist without clinging to it.
Han and Leia feel like the aftermath of that kind of intensity. They argue, they clash, they orbit each other like theyâre constantly figuring it out in real time. But their love survives things it really shouldnâtâwar, distance, loss, even the fracture of their own family. It changes shape over time, gets heavier, quieter, less cinematic. And somehow that makes it more honest. They donât get a perfect ending. They get something real.
Obi-Wan and Satine are the embodiment of restraint. They stand on opposite sides of belief, yet understand each other more than anyone else ever does. Thereâs something devastating about the fact that nothing actually stops them from being together except who theyâve chosen to be. Itâs love that asks, âwho are you when everything is stripped away?â And both of them answer with duty, even when it costs them everything else.
Qui-Gon and Tahl feel almost like a secret the galaxy barely notices. Their connection is quiet, steady, something that exists beneath the surface rather than out in the open. And when she dies, it doesnât explode into spectacleâit settles into him. His grief becomes part of his philosophy, part of the way he sees the Force. Like love didnât end, it just⌠changed form and stayed with him.
Kanan and Hera are what happens when love is allowed to grow instead of rush. It builds through trust, through shared purpose, through the small moments in between everything else. They donât need constant declarations. Itâs in the way they stand beside each other, the way they lead together, the way they create a sense of home in a life that rarely offers one. And when loss comes, it doesnât undo what they had. It proves how strong it was.
Cal Kestis and Merrin feel like two people who werenât supposed to find peace, finding it anyway. Both of them come from devastationâdifferent kinds, same weight. And instead of trying to fix each other, they just understand. Thereâs patience in the way they connect, like they both know how easily things can fall apart, so they choose to build something steady instead. Itâs love that heals without pretending the scars arenât there.
Ventress and Quinlan Vos are chaos that somehow becomes something honest. They meet in the middle of war, deception, and moral grayness, and still manage to see each other clearly. And whatâs striking is that their love actually changes the direction of a life. Quinlan falls into darkness, loses himself completely, and itâs Ventress who pulls him backânot through rules or ideals, but through connection. And she pays for that with her life. Their story doesnât pretend love saves everyone. It shows that sometimes it saves someone else, and thatâs enough.
Rey and Ben are something else entirelyâtwo people tied together before they even understand what that connection means. Theirs is recognition at its most intense. They see each other across distance, across conflict, across everything that tells them they should be enemies. And even when everything collapses, that bond remains. It doesnât simplify anything. It complicates everything. But it also makes change possible.
And thatâs the thing Star Wars keeps coming back to, over and over again.
Love isnât safe here.
It doesnât exist in peaceful conditions. It exists in war zones, in broken systems, in people who are already carrying too much. And because of that, it becomes a test.
Sometimes it becomes attachment, and that destroys you.
Sometimes it becomes partnership, and that sustains you.
Sometimes it becomes sacrifice, and that outlives you.
But every single time, it reveals who you really are.
Because in a galaxy built on destiny, prophecy, and endless conflict, the most defining choice anyone ever makes is still thisâ
who do you hold onto, when everything else is trying to pull you apart?
